Skip to content
Snippets Groups Projects
  1. Sep 01, 2020
  2. Aug 31, 2020
  3. Aug 30, 2020
  4. Aug 28, 2020
    • Peter Maydell's avatar
      Merge remote-tracking branch 'remotes/vivier2/tags/linux-user-for-5.2-pull-request' into staging · 39335fab
      Peter Maydell authored
      
      add utimensat_time64, semtimedop_time64, rt_sigtimedwait_time64,
          sched_rr_get_interval_time64, clock_nanosleep_time64, clock_adjtime64,
          mq_timedsend_time64, mq_timedreceive_time64
      fix semop, semtimedop, clock_nanosleep, mq_timedsend, target_to_host_timespec64
      fix tembits.h
      add more strace function
      Add upport DRM_IOCTL_I915_GETPARAM
      detect mismatched ELF ABI in qemu-mips[n32][el]
      
      # gpg: Signature made Fri 28 Aug 2020 14:37:33 BST
      # gpg:                using RSA key CD2F75DDC8E3A4DC2E4F5173F30C38BD3F2FBE3C
      # gpg:                issuer "laurent@vivier.eu"
      # gpg: Good signature from "Laurent Vivier <lvivier@redhat.com>" [full]
      # gpg:                 aka "Laurent Vivier <laurent@vivier.eu>" [full]
      # gpg:                 aka "Laurent Vivier (Red Hat) <lvivier@redhat.com>" [full]
      # Primary key fingerprint: CD2F 75DD C8E3 A4DC 2E4F  5173 F30C 38BD 3F2F BE3C
      
      * remotes/vivier2/tags/linux-user-for-5.2-pull-request:
        linux-user: Add support for utimensat_time64() and semtimedop_time64()
        linux-user: Add support for 'rt_sigtimedwait_time64()' and 'sched_rr_get_interval_time64()'
        linux-user: Add support for 'clock_nanosleep_time64()' and 'clock_adjtime64()'
        linux-user: Add support for 'mq_timedsend_time64()' and 'mq_timedreceive_time64()'
        linux-user: fix target_to_host_timespec64()
        linux-user: Fix 'mq_timedsend()' and 'mq_timedreceive()'
        linux-user: detect mismatched ELF ABI in qemu-mips[n32][el]
        linux-user: Add strace support for printing arguments for ioctls used for terminals and serial lines
        linux-user: Add missing termbits types and values definitions
        linux-user: Add generic 'termbits.h' for some archs
        linux-user: Add strace support for printing arguments of some clock and time functions
        linux-user: Add an api to print enumareted argument values with strace
        linux-user: Add strace support for printing arguments of syscalls used to lock and unlock memory
        linux-user: Add strace support for printing arguments of truncate()/ftruncate() and getsid()
        linux-user: Make cpu_env accessible in strace.c
        linux-user: syscall: ioctls: support DRM_IOCTL_I915_GETPARAM
        linux-user: Fix 'clock_nanosleep()' implementation
        linux-user: Fix 'semop()' and 'semtimedop()' implementation
      
      Signed-off-by: default avatarPeter Maydell <peter.maydell@linaro.org>
      39335fab
    • LIU Zhiwei's avatar
      softfloat: Define misc operations for bfloat16 · 5ebf5f4b
      LIU Zhiwei authored
      
      Signed-off-by: default avatarLIU Zhiwei <zhiwei_liu@c-sky.com>
      Reviewed-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      Message-Id: <20200813071421.2509-4-zhiwei_liu@c-sky.com>
      [rth: Fix merge conflict with NO_SIGNALING_NANS; use bool for predicates.]
      Signed-off-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      5ebf5f4b
    • LIU Zhiwei's avatar
      softfloat: Define convert operations for bfloat16 · 34f0c0a9
      LIU Zhiwei authored
      
      Signed-off-by: default avatarLIU Zhiwei <zhiwei_liu@c-sky.com>
      Reviewed-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      Message-Id: <20200813071421.2509-3-zhiwei_liu@c-sky.com>
      [rth: Use FloatRoundMode for conversion functions.]
      Signed-off-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      34f0c0a9
    • LIU Zhiwei's avatar
      softfloat: Define operations for bfloat16 · 8282310d
      LIU Zhiwei authored
      
      This patch implements operations for bfloat16 except conversion and some misc
      operations. We also add FloatFmt and pack/unpack interfaces for bfloat16.
      As they are both static fields, we can't make a sperate patch for them.
      
      Signed-off-by: default avatarLIU Zhiwei <zhiwei_liu@c-sky.com>
      Reviewed-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      Message-Id: <20200813071421.2509-2-zhiwei_liu@c-sky.com>
      [rth: Use FloatRelation for comparison operations.]
      Signed-off-by: default avatarRichard Henderson <richard.henderson@linaro.org>
      8282310d
Loading